LAHORE, April 4: The Sui Northern Gas Pipelines Limited (SNGPL) has suspended gas supply to five power plants in Punjab, says a press release.

The power plants are Orient, Saphire, Fauji Kabirwala, Rousch and Saif Power.

Consequently, the Pakistan Electric Power Company (Pepco) has to face electricity shortfall of another 1,000MW in its system, with no option left but to increase loadshedding (one hour in urban areas and two hours in rural areas) in its jurisdiction.

A Pepco spokesman has assured power consumers that loadshedding duration will be cut as soon as gas supply to these power houses is restored. 68MW electricity: With the availability of water, both main units of the Khan Khwar Hydropower Station have started generating 68MW electricity as per their cumulative installed capacity, delivering over 1.1 million units of electricity to the national grid daily, which is equivalent to over Rs10 million revenue.

The third auxiliary unit of 4MW will also go into operation soon.

The Khan Khwar Hydropower Station started its commercial operation in December 2010.

The 72MW Khan Khwar Hydropower Station, one of the three high-head hydropower projects, has been constructed on Khan Khwar (river), a tributary of the River Indus near Besham in Shangla district of Khyber Pakhtunkhwa province.

Rest of the two projects namely 121MW Allai Khwar and 130MW Duber Khwar are also at the advance stage of their completion. — Staff Reporter
